Unlock instant, AI-driven research and patent intelligence for your innovation.

A Realization System of Remote Invoking Service Framework

A service framework and remote invocation technology, applied in transmission systems, digital transmission systems, inter-program communication, etc., can solve problems such as high technical and resource investment requirements, unfriendly packaging, and increased difficulty in service docking, etc., to achieve simplified invocation effect of complexity

Active Publication Date: 2021-06-18
SUNING CONSUMER FINANCE CO LTD
View PDF5 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Since the mutual calling between systems involves the assembly and disassembly of underlying communication and messages, the implementation of each system poses a great challenge to technical requirements and resource costs
And the difficulty of connecting services between systems will be greatly increased due to the lack of a unified calling framework for their respective implementations
At present, similar calling frameworks on the market are either complex and require high technology and resource investment, or the packaging is not friendly enough to use, and a lot of secondary development is still required.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• A Realization System of Remote Invoking Service Framework
  • A Realization System of Remote Invoking Service Framework
  • A Realization System of Remote Invoking Service Framework

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0027] The present invention is described in further detail now in conjunction with accompanying drawing.

[0028] The present invention mainly includes the following modules, a unified configuration module, a unified calling API module, a sending module, an encoding / decoding module, a receiving module and the like. Through the interaction and transfer between the above several modules, the communication between the message from the requester (that is, the client) to the server (that is, the server) is realized. The server has a server that provides remote services. For the process interaction, see figure 1 .

[0029] Unified configuration module:

[0030] This module is mainly used to initialize the configuration of the remote call service framework. The configuration method is based on the spring-style xml file method, including configuring the service application name (generally the application name of the server) and the mapping between the IP address and port, and the ex...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

An implementation system of a remote call service framework, mainly including a configuration module, an API module, a sending module, an encoding module, a decoding module, a receiving module, etc. Through the interaction and transfer between the above modules, the message is transferred from the requester to the service communication between parties. The system is based on Netty, a stable open source NIO framework widely used in the industry, and provides point-to-point synchronous calls, asynchronous calls, and asynchronous calls based on the CallBack mechanism. To facilitate maintenance and communication, the remote call service framework is named SIF framework. The present invention provides a unified programming model, simplifies the complexity of calling, and enables developers to focus more on the realization of business logic; solves the problem that cross-system online transaction business logs are difficult to track and analyze; solves the need for traffic flow when the concurrent pressure is too large The problem of control.

Description

technical field [0001] The invention belongs to the fields of Socket communication and RPC calling, and in particular relates to a system for realizing a remote calling service framework. Background technique [0002] Now more and more companies use distributed technology to deploy applications, and the deployment of applications is divided into more and more fine-grained functional modules, resulting in a sharp increase in the deployment of applications, and more and more frequent interactions between applications. Since the mutual calling between systems involves the assembly and disassembly of underlying communication and messages, the implementation of each system poses a great challenge to technical requirements and resource costs. Moreover, the difficulty of connecting services between systems will be greatly increased due to the lack of a unified calling framework for their respective implementations. At present, similar calling frameworks on the market are either co...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): G06F9/54G06F8/60H04L12/24H04L29/08
CPCG06F8/60G06F9/547H04L41/50H04L67/025H04L67/30
Inventor 贾建华郑梦久韩志远单园庆
Owner SUNING CONSUMER FINANCE CO LTD